Hit or Miss With Bagged Produce

Tina May 18, 2026

These avocados can be really good when you get a fresh bag — creamy, flavorful, and perfect for toast, salads, and guacamole. However, the quality is a bit hit or miss. Sometimes the entire bag is great, but other times a few avocados are already overripe or have brown spots inside. Because of the inconsistency, I've started buying fewer pre-bagged produce items and choosing individual avocados instead. The price for organic avocados is still decent, but quality control could definitely be better.
